Our Responsibilities

  • We will ensure you have meaningful and regular access to your manager to support your personal development and career trajectory.
  • We will actively reward performance with promotions, pay increases and a discretionary annual bonus of up to 10% of salary to all employees.
  • We ensure Koto is an equal environment for all its employees.
  • We will support you in taking family leave and offer significant paid maternity and paternity.
  • We will actively encourage you to take 25 days holiday yearly, in addition to UK bank holidays (on average eight), one additional holiday day per year (capped at 5 additional days), and a studio closure between Christmas and New Year.
  • We will contribute an additional 3% to anyone wanting to engage in the Scottish Widows pension scheme.
  • We offer private medical insurance via Vitality Health and a monthly ‘employee wellness’ benefits package via Juno of £75 per month.
  • We offer access to YCN and fund relevant training opportunities to any employee looking to develop themselves and career.
  • We reward five years of service with £5,000 and five days holiday. We reward ten years of service with £10,000 and four weeks holiday.
  • We will give you the opportunity to work from any of the four Koto studios globally, with appropriate planning and application.
